Delhi police arrest murder accused in Jamshedpur

A Delhi police team arrested an accused in murder and abduction cases from Mango area in East Singhbhum district.

A Delhi police team on Saturday arrested an accused in murder and abduction cases from Mango area in Jamshedpur, east Singhbhum district.

However, two of the three cars carrying police personnel, was initially "detained" by Jharkhand police due to a communication gap.

Additional SP Sudhir Kumar Jha said after it was known that the arrested man Rajvir Singh had been wanted by the Delhi police under Sections 302 and 365 of IPC, the two cars were allowed to leave.

Jha said, quoting information available tonight, that the eight-member Delhi police team, led by Inspector B Dutt had been camping in the steel city for the last six days in search of Singh and finally apprehended him on Saturday.

However as police personnel in civil dress were taking Singh in a car in full public view, a rumour spread about his being abducted, and a crowd suspecting something amiss intercepted two other cars which were trailing behind.

As the local police "detained" the two cars, with three persons on board, the occupants identified themselves as members of Delhi Police team and gave details about Singh's arrest and cases pending against him in the national capital.

Other members of the Delhi Police team, led by Inspector Dutt, meanwhile took away Singh in the first vehicle on way to Delhi, Jha said.
